Barriers to Energy Accessibility in Rural Minnesota
Rural communities in Minnesota face significant barriers to energy independence, particularly when it comes to the adoption of modern clean energy solutions like hydrogen. A report from the Minnesota Department of Commerce noted that rural areas often have higher energy costs and less access to renewable energy technologies compared to urban centers. Over 700,000 residents live in areas classified as energy-poor, meaning they struggle to afford basic energy needs. This disparity significantly hampers economic growth and sustainability in these communities.
Who Faces These Energy Challenges?
In Minnesota’s rural landscapes, residents, farmers, and small businesses often deal with limited energy options, making them susceptible to price fluctuations in fossil fuels. The lack of infrastructure also creates hurdles in deploying renewable energy technologies, leaving communities reliant on traditional energy sources that contribute to environmental degradation. For farming operations, which require significant energy for production tasks, the absence of localized renewable solutions often leads to increased operational costs, jeopardizing their viability.
